Analysis
In 2024, average hourly earnings of employees in Dominican Republic stood at 6.94 international-$ in 2021 prices. That is the highest value across all 12 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 6.2% on the previous year and up 102.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, average hourly earnings of employees in Dominican Republic peaked at 6.94 international-$ in 2021 prices in 2024 and was at its lowest, 3.38 international-$ in 2021 prices, in 1998.
That places Dominican Republic 33rd out of 64 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 12 years of available data.
